Rewards for specific order statuses only
This is a great plugin, but there was a one small issue for me - it would give reward points to all orders with status id >= than the one specified. Unfortunately, this is not practical in my shopping cart as I have scattered statuses for which I need to give reward points. I believe this is the case for most carts with default setup (Cancel status = 5 , which is less than Shipped status = 3 , etc. )
I figured out a fix, so if anyone else is interested, you can do the same:
1. Replace function "_check_order_status" in store_credit.php file with:
Code:
function _check_order_status($orders_id) {
global $db;
$order_query = "SELECT orders_status FROM " . TABLE_ORDERS . "
WHERE orders_id = " . $orders_id . "
LIMIT 1";
$order_status = $db->Execute($order_query);
$order_status_rewarded = explode(",", MODULE_ORDER_TOTAL_SC_ORDER_REWARD_STATUS);
if (in_array($order_status->fields['orders_status'], $order_status_rewarded)) {
return true;
} else {
return false;
}
}
2. Run this SQL on your DB:
Code:
UPDATE zen_configuration
SET use_function=NULL, set_function=NULL
WHERE configuration_title = "Required Order Status"
3. Go to Admin -> Modules -> Order Total -> Store Credit -> Edit -> in Required Order Status field, write the order ids delimited by comas for which you'd like to give rewards (for example: "3,102")

Quick correction for the above. This is a more proper way to do it.
Instead of 2nd step, do the following:
- in /includes/modules/order_total/ot_sc.php file, replace
Code:
//$db->Execute("insert into " . TABLE_CONFIGURATION . " (configuration_title, configuration_key, configuration_value, configuration_description, configuration_group_id, sort_order, set_function, use_function, date_added) values ('Required Order Status', 'MODULE_ORDER_TOTAL_SC_ORDER_REWARD_STATUS', '2', 'What order status is required to receive reward points?', '6', '4', 'zen_cfg_pull_down_order_statuses(', 'zen_get_order_status_name', now())");
by
Code:
$db->Execute("insert into " . TABLE_CONFIGURATION . " (configuration_title, configuration_key, configuration_value, configuration_description, configuration_group_id, sort_order, date_added) values ('Required Order Status', 'MODULE_ORDER_TOTAL_SC_ORDER_REWARD_STATUS', '2', 'What order status is required to receive reward points?', '6', '4', now())");
- under Admin -> Modules -> Order Total -> Store Credit -> click "Remove" followed by "Install"

Slomojojo's solution reveals that there is more than one type of tag in PHP: apparently Store Credit Module uses a short opening php tag: <?.
Slomojojo stated he went into each of the files (there are many) and searched for <? and replaced it with <?php.
When I read his clarification today that (thank you so much, slomojojo), the same thing is accomplished on a test WAMP server by simply opening PHP settings and enabling "short open tag" if it's off, it finally made sense to me as being a PHP tag problem.
That did indeed fix the error everywhere AT ONCE.
